response = client.search("Python programming")from serpshot import SerpShot
client = SerpShot(
api_key="your-api-key", # Optional: Your SerpShot API key (or set SERPSHOT_API_KEY env var)
base_url=None, # Optional: Custom API endpoint
timeout=30.0, # Optional: Request timeout in seconds
max_retries=3, # Optional: Maximum retry attempts
)Perform a Google search. Supports both single query and batch queries (up to 100 queries per request).
from serpshot import SerpShot
# Single search
response = client.search(
query="search query", # Required: Search query string or list of queries (max 100)
num=10, # Optional: Number of results per page (1-100)
page=1, # Optional: Page number for pagination (starts from 1)
gl="us", # Optional: Country code (e.g., 'us', 'uk', 'cn')
hl="en", # Optional: Language code (e.g., 'en', 'zh-CN')
lr="en", # Optional: Content language restriction (e.g., 'en', 'zh-CN')
location="US", # Optional: Location for local search (e.g., 'US', 'GB', 'CN')
)
# Batch search (recommended for multiple queries)
responses = client.search(
query=["Python", "JavaScript", "Rust"], # List of queries (1-100)
num=10,
gl="us",
location="US", # String location parameter supported
)
# Returns list[SearchResponse] when query is a listNote: The location parameter accepts strings (recommended) or LocationType enum values.
Perform a Google image search. Supports both single query and batch queries (up to 100 queries per request).
# Single image search
response = client.image_search(
query="cute puppies", # Required: Image search query string or list (max 100)
num=10, # Optional: Number of results per page (1-100)
page=1, # Optional: Page number for pagination (starts from 1)
gl="us", # Optional: Country code
hl="en", # Optional: Language code
lr="en", # Optional: Content language restriction
)
# Batch image search
responses = client.image_search(
query=["cats", "dogs", "birds"], # List of queries (1-100)
num=10,
)The SearchResponse object contains:
class SearchResponse:
success: bool # Request success status
query: str # Original search query
total_results: str # Estimate of total results (e.g., "About 12,300,000 results")
search_time: str # Search execution time in seconds (as string)
results: list[SearchResult] | list[ImageResult] # List of search results
credits_used: int # Credits consumedNote: When using batch search (passing a list of queries), search() returns list[SearchResponse] instead of a single SearchResponse.
Each result in response.results contains:
class SearchResult:
title: str # Result title
link: str # Result URL
snippet: str # Description snippet
position: int # Position in results (1-based)For image searches, results contain:
class ImageResult:
title: str # Image title
link: str # Image source URL
thumbnail: str # Thumbnail URL
source: str # Source website
source_link: str # Source page URL
width: int # Image width in pixels
height: int # Image height in pixels
position: int # Result positionBatch search allows you to process multiple queries (up to 100) in a single API call, which is more efficient than separate calls:

asyncio.run(main())from serpshot import (
SerpShot,
AuthenticationError,
RateLimitError,
InsufficientCreditsError,
APIError,
NetworkError,
)
try:
with SerpShot(api_key="your-api-key") as client:
response = client.search("test query")
except AuthenticationError as e:
print(f"Invalid API key: {e}")
except RateLimitError as e:
print(f"Rate limit exceeded. Retry after {e.retry_after}s")
except InsufficientCreditsError as e:
print(f"Insufficient credits. Need: {e.credits_required}")
except APIError as e:
print(f"API error ({e.status_code}): {e.message}")
except NetworkError as e:
print(f"Network error: {e}")client = SerpShot(
